So, what does our build require? For weapons, we choose Executioner’s Greataxe. It has a solid 115 critical damage followed by strong strength scaling.
In addition, we need Ash of War Cragblade, brew Flask of Wondrous Physick, and obtain three Insignia Talismans each: Axe Talisman, Blue Dancer Charm, and Ritual Sword Talisman.
Don’t forget that the most important thing is to prepare enough Elden Ring Runes, whether it is to equip weapons or upgrade stats, this is crucial.
First, let’s start with the basics of farming Greyoll Dragon. But before we head to the dragon, let’s quickly get Lordsworn’s Greatsword, which we’ll later upgrade with Ash of War Sacred Blade to easily use our primary weapon.
On the way to Baron, we naturally grabbed the two halves of Dectus Medallion, all Souls, and other fun stuff at each campfire. For example, while riding to reach the first half of Fort Haight, we can grab Axe Talisman in Mistwood Ruins, which increases the damage of charged attacks. Just nearby, close to the gigantic tree, we can also find Crystal Tear.
In addition, we have to smash the lowly dung beetle north of Third Church of Marika to get Ash of War Sacred Blade.
Once we find Greyoll, quickly grab the back half of Medallion and take him down the usual way. You then need to divide your hard-earned Souls as follows: 20 for Vigor, and the remaining Souls for one real stat, Strength. Don’t forget to continue collecting Boss Souls during the rest of your journey.
Now we are ready to start farming our weapons. Imprint Ash of War on Greatsword, then travel to Liurnia of the Lakes. Ride past Stormveil Castle on the right and reach the first bonfire in Liurnia.
From there, you can already see a church, behind which the thugs with Executioner’s Greataxe are waiting. We can defeat him with Ash of War until he drops our axe. This enemy has a 5% drop chance, which may sound small at first, but it never took me more than 15 minutes.
We now have a coveted weapon that only requires the necessary leveling materials. Well, head to Liurnia of the Lakes and quickly get the key from the dragon, then head straight to Raya Lucaria Crystal Tunnel where we’ll get Smithing Miner’s Bell Bearing [1] and upgrade our Greataxe to +6.
When we were done, we could beat the crap out of our opponents. But we also need a proper Ash of War.
To the southeast of Fort Gael, at the bottom of Caelid, we will get Ash of War Cragblade, which gives our weapons 15% more poise and 10% more damage. This also makes this Strength build even crazier.
Also, don’t forget to upgrade your axe to heavy immediately for better strength scaling.
Now, there is another Talisman that is very important. It is a Blue Dancer. Head to Stormveil Castle, ride east to the bridge next to Mad Pumpkin Head, and cross the vortex into the depths. In the cave, after defeating the boss, we will find Blue Dancer Charm, which increases our damage at a low equipment weight.
Another high-level Medallion is Ritual Sword Talisman, which gives us an additional 10% damage when the health is full. Take the grand elevator to Altus Plateau. From there, head north to Lux Ruins, briefly applaud Queen, and pick up this gorgeous piece of gear from the chest.
We are far from done. From the ruins, enter Sealed Tunnel, go through the gate and climb the stairs, where you can obtain Smithing Miner’s Bell Bearing [2]. Now you can upgrade your axe to +12 and you will have B-scaling in strength.
Now that everything is ready, here comes the slightly tricky part. We will return to the bonfire in Fort Faroth and defeat Putrid Avatar under the tree. He’s a bit tricky in my opinion, but with focus, it can definitely be done.
It only took me about three or four charged attacks to break his stance, and after about two or three turns, he would die and drop Crystal Tear. Together with the previous one, we will brew a Flask of Wondrous Physick. It further increases the charged attack and stance damage dealt.
Now we want to bring the weapon up to A-scaling. We can find many Smithing Stones in Caelid’s Sellia Crystal Tunnel and Altus Tunnel. Once you have all Smithing Stones, you can upgrade your axe one last time to +18, with A-scaling. Now you are ready to start a glorious adventure!

Dark Hide is a rare material in New World that can be obtained by skinning high-level beasts and is used to craft powerful armor and weapons that require a high level of Skinning skill. For example, you can use it in the step of making Prismatic Leather.
As you can see, the current price of Dark Hide in America Northeast region is not very high at 0.65 to 0.75 gold per coin, but you can earn some pretty good coins from it as well.
Let’s start by talking about some tips you need to pay attention to when farming. First, don’t forget to wear farming gear. In my case, these items bring me Skinning Luck.
By the way, Regular Luck and Trade Skill Luck are completely different things. The first increases the drop rate of enemy items, and the second gives you additional resources during gathering. Here we need the second one.
The best item to increase farm luck is Earring. An Earring can give you almost +10% extra luck. And don’t forget to respec your attributes. We need maximum Dexterity, which will increase our yield and luck.
Killing mobs in some areas will drop up to 100 Dark Hide. If available, you can use Savory Fish Cake so you can increase your chances of getting rare items when skinning them, as well as get a little extra gold.
In addition, playing music can also increase your gathering yield. If you wish, you can also use Powerful Proficiency Boost, which increases the amount of resources collected using tools by 15% for 30 minutes.
Next, let’s talk about a few of the best locations for farming Dark Hide in Season 5.
Our first farming site is located in Dredged Landing in the lower right corner of the map. You can see two Shrines here, and you can see the path from one Shrine to the other. There are many lions and scarabs on your path. Farm them to get Dark Hide, Scarhide and Smolderhide. But the drop rate of the latter two is smaller, which is why we need farm luck.
Also at the bottom of the map, where Crocodiles appear, brings us the same resources. You can run and farm the location in a loop.
Another really cool place is Isle of Zurvan. Shrine of the Lion is in this area, and you can also go here to attack Mammoths, but your main farming target here is Chameleon. They are fast and disappear at any time, but are easily killed. The best way is to get close to them so they don’t disappear.
After you kill these Chameleons, you can go over and fight those Mammoths like I said. You can earn thousands of gold coins per hour using this method.
Of course, you can use things like your horse and fast travel to speed up farming efficiency. But in reality, these locations are very close, so it doesn’t make much sense.
In addition, there are a lot of lions here, and killing them will drop a lot of Dark Hide. What’s more, there’s a high monster density here, with 25 to 30 appearing at once not uncommon, making this a quick farming location. Especially if you use a powerful weapon like an Axe or a Spear, you’ll most likely be able to kill them super fast here.
Another location worth paying attention to is Elysian Wilds, where most enemies that drop Dark Hide can be found around the entire area. Most of the enemies here are level 63 and above, so make sure you’re above that and head in any direction that has a variety of beasts in an area to increase your farming efficiency.
I will list three locations with more animal habitats: Hornhold Labyrinth, Shirzad’s Pride, and an elite area in the southern Elysian Wilds.
At the entrance to Elite Zone, you have by far the best spot to farm Dark Hide, where you’ll hunt Mammoths. This area is full of them. They are very high level and are powerful opponents, but their rewards are also very large. Try taking them one by one to make your farming easier. Don’t forget that when you have good gear, you will fight multiple enemies.
The last location is at the end of the elite area in Abandoned Temple. This area is full of lions, and they may offer fewer rewards than Mammoths. However, they are top level, and the higher the level of a creature, the rarer the loot it receives. It should be noted that you can skin Vanash here, so that you can also get some designated item drops.

What is the difference between KMSM and global version? Some Redditors gave their own answers and judgments on Reddit MapleStory M community regarding a recent thread upon the Korean version' experience. Here are some quotes from this discussion:
"Korean version is so much different from the Global version. Here are some key differences:
Available character classes: Phantom, Luminous, Mercedes, Evan, Aran, Explorers (Including Paladin and Hero), KoC
Equipment classifications: In the trade market, the equip are classified according to levels 10, 20, 40, etc till level 160, ranging from all sorts of weapons to accessories. Characters can only equip the next higher tier equip upon reaching the next level tier (10,20,30,40, etc). For each level tier, there are sub tiers which classifies the equip to normal, rare, epic, unique.
Level cap is 200.
Lots of event dungeons.
Equipment drop rates: I started a new character and even the weakest monsters (blue snails, green snails) drop equipment at quite a high rate.
I feel that the global version basically is a cash cow for Nexon. Korean Maplestory M feels a lot more like the PC version. So many more features..."

MapleStory M is the chill multiplayer mobile version of the popular 2D MMORPG, MapleStory. In it, you’ll explore the world’s peaceful isles, level up, make friends, and go on quests with other players. One of the most popular features is pets.
Pets and minions are a pretty common feature in lots of MMORPGs, but in MapleStory M they are a little more interesting. Not only do they follow you around and act all cute, they also serve different purposes in battle such as using your potions for you when your health gets low or picking up items. If you ever played Castle Crashers, they are a little bit similar to that. You can equip them by going to your character screen, and then tapping Pets. From that menu, you can see all the ones you have available to you and swap them in/out for a maximum of three. You can also feed them to level them up using Pet Food which allows them to provide additional buffs to you while exploring the world of MapleStory M.
To get new and different ones, complete quests and some of them may contain pets as a reward. Free daily rewards may also contain pets. Finally, you can also use real-life money to purchase optional ones from MapleStory M’s cash store. From what we can see, these ones from the store don’t appear to be any more/or less powerful than the normal ones you can get, at least not at level 1. They are just cute and are different from the ones you normally would find.

It’s one of your most dreaded fears, and now it’s here before your very eyes: “illegal program has been detected”. Not only is it lacking in grammatical elegance – periods are important, guys – but it forbids you from accessing MapleStory M.
So what gives? Why have you been able to access the game perfectly unimpeded, only to have this warning pop up now, of all times? The first thing to realize is that the program detection system isn’t perfect; it will miss things upon launch sometimes, and catch it later on.
The most obvious fix, clearly, is to uninstall any cheat programs that you may have on your device. Anything that is made with the intention of altering or hacking the game should be uninstalled immediately. Otherwise, you run the risk of your account being banned permanently. Note that you do not have to be running these programs during gameplay in order for them to be detected; if the scans detect it, uninstalling is your only option.
The illegal program message is also known to trigger in phones that are rooted or jailbroken. If your phone is second hand and you are unaware of its background, this could potentially be the case, as well.
As a final fix, try reinstalling MapleStory M and relaunching it without any other programs running, even ones that are completely unrelated to hacking. You might have an innocuous app that is somehow triggering the warning.
Failing all of this, your best bet is to get in contact with Nexon directly and report your issue. As MapleStory M is newly launched on mobile, it is bound to have some hiccups here and there, and the best way to prevent this from happening is to inform the developers quickly and politely.
